Output 6313e657912393e86b93c165037e05caaa9fdd7b139ecdf8c34f271313e74ff7:9

value
17358610
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73d4268eeaea8c3417d304bdff7de43137c4fdac OP_EQUALVERIFY OP_CHECKSIG
address
1BZSrYYb1pyCsYXLzmnteJMTJqNP2tqh7G
transaction
6313e657912393e86b93c165037e05caaa9fdd7b139ecdf8c34f271313e74ff7
spent
true